diff --git a/config-arm-generic b/config-arm-generic index 324579b1f..5aabaa67b 100644 --- a/config-arm-generic +++ b/config-arm-generic @@ -13,6 +13,10 @@ CONFIG_OABI_COMPAT=y CONFIG_VFP=y CONFIG_ARM_UNWIND=y +CONFIG_SMP=y +CONFIG_NR_CPUS=4 +CONFIG_SMP_ON_UP=y + # CONFIG_FPE_NWFPE is not set CONFIG_FPE_FASTFPE=y diff --git a/config-arm-omap b/config-arm-omap index 11887ec15..f53d7d3bc 100644 --- a/config-arm-omap +++ b/config-arm-omap @@ -116,11 +116,8 @@ CONFIG_ARM_ERRATA_720789=y CONFIG_ARM_GIC=y # CONFIG_PCI_SYSCALL is not set # CONFIG_PCCARD is not set -CONFIG_SMP=y -CONFIG_SMP_ON_UP=y CONFIG_HAVE_ARM_SCU=y CONFIG_HAVE_ARM_TWD=y -CONFIG_NR_CPUS=2 CONFIG_HOTPLUG_CPU=y CONFIG_LOCAL_TIMERS=y CONFIG_HZ=128 diff --git a/config-arm-tegra b/config-arm-tegra index 0a169eced..1f20ce7f9 100644 --- a/config-arm-tegra +++ b/config-arm-tegra @@ -48,7 +48,6 @@ CONFIG_ARM_ERRATA_720789=y # CONFIG_ARM_ERRATA_754322 is not set # CONFIG_ARM_ERRATA_754327 is not set # CONFIG_ARM_ERRATA_764369 is not set -CONFIG_SMP_ON_UP=y CONFIG_LOCAL_TIMERS=y # CONFIG_THUMB2_KERNEL is not set # CONFIG_NEON is not set diff --git a/config-arm-versatile b/config-arm-versatile index 83cb9d7a9..207042501 100644 --- a/config-arm-versatile +++ b/config-arm-versatile @@ -1,11 +1,23 @@ -CONFIG_ARM=y - CONFIG_ARCH_VEXPRESS=y CONFIG_ARCH_VEXPRESS_CA9X4=y - -CONFIG_PLAT_VERSATILE=y CONFIG_PLAT_VERSATILE_CLCD=y CONFIG_PLAT_VERSATILE_SCHED_CLOCK=y +CONFIG_PLAT_VERSATILE=y +CONFIG_ARM_TIMER_SP804=y + +CONFIG_CPU_V7=y +CONFIG_CPU_32v6K=y +CONFIG_CPU_32v7=y +CONFIG_CPU_ABRT_EV7=y +CONFIG_CPU_PABRT_V7=y +CONFIG_CPU_CACHE_V7=y +CONFIG_CPU_CACHE_VIPT=y +CONFIG_CPU_COPY_V6=y +CONFIG_CPU_TLB_V7=y +CONFIG_CPU_HAS_ASID=y +CONFIG_CPU_CP15=y +CONFIG_CPU_CP15_MMU=y +CONFIG_CPU_HAS_PMU=y # Need to verify whether these are generic or vexpress specific CONFIG_ARM_AMBA=y @@ -15,21 +27,6 @@ CONFIG_VFP=y CONFIG_VFPv3=y CONFIG_CPUSETS=y -CONFIG_CPU_32v6K=y -CONFIG_CPU_32v7=y -CONFIG_CPU_ABRT_EV7=y -CONFIG_CPU_CACHE_V7=y -CONFIG_CPU_CACHE_VIPT=y -CONFIG_CPU_COPY_V6=y -CONFIG_CPU_CP15=y -CONFIG_CPU_CP15_MMU=y -CONFIG_CPU_HAS_ASID=y -CONFIG_CPU_HAS_PMU=y -CONFIG_CPU_PABRT_V7=y -CONFIG_CPU_RMAP=y -CONFIG_CPU_TLB_V7=y -CONFIG_CPU_V7=y - # CONFIG_THUMB2_AVOID_R_ARM_THM_JUMP11 is not set # CONFIG_THUMB2_KERNEL is not set CONFIG_TICK_ONESHOT=y diff --git a/kernel.spec b/kernel.spec index d448a4ade..332ee7f72 100644 --- a/kernel.spec +++ b/kernel.spec @@ -2326,6 +2326,10 @@ fi # ||----w | # || || %changelog +* Tue May 15 2012 Dennis Gilmore +- make sure smp is on in generic arm config +- tweak vexpress config + * Mon May 14 2012 Josh Boyer - Enable DRM_VIA again per Adam Jackson